Zion players and collectors gravitate toward the classic Blue-Eyes White Dragon and Dark Magician, as well as Exodia the Forbidden One and Red-Eyes Black Dragon. Tournament and collectible favorites like Ash Blossom & Joyous Spring and Pot of Greed also see demand. First editions, secret rares, and graded cards continue to capture attention.
Condition and professional grading boost card values significantly. Limited print runs, first edition distinctions, and popularity in tournament play enhance demand. Foil and holographic designs add rarity, while recent sales and collector interest shape ongoing value trends.
